c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
3821
Views
6
Helpful
9
Replies

Client roaming issues on C9800

Ingénierie RCI
Level 1
Level 1

Hello,

 

We have a problem with a C9800 Wireless Controller (version 17.9.4a) and Cisco C9120 Access Points. Some clients are roaming from one AP to another, while there're not moving from their desk. For exemple, as shown in the exemple, a client in a meeting room is roaming among 3 AP in a short amount of time : 

IngnierieRCI_0-1731943277481.png

Even if the latency is high, the client decide to roam without moving.

The access points and the controller are in differents network, the C9800 is running on a virtual machine on Microsoft Azure. 

All the AP are in Flexconnect mode, and the policy on the WLAN is only configured in Central Authentication :

IngnierieRCI_1-1731944165182.png

We've modified the Data Rate on the RF-Profile, to force Access Point to disassociate clients with a poor rate from an AP, and force them to connect to a closer AP 

IngnierieRCI_2-1731944540419.png

 

Do you have any clue about why the client still decide to roam without moving. 

I attach the "show-tech-support-wireless" file with the configuration and firmware information

Postscript  : The device shown in the history is a updated Windows 10 Laptop. 

 

9 Replies 9

Mark Elsen
Hall of Fame
Hall of Fame

 

    - Feed your  attachment into : Wireless Config Analyzer
       At least all red errors in the wlc checkresults (html view or excell) should be corrected , but review the other advisories too such as RF related.

     + Client roaming decisions are always autonomous , make sure the layout of the wireless network was done properly with wireless
site survey
    - 17.9.x is becoming gradually EOL , consider moving on to 17.12.3

 M.



-- Let everything happen to you  
       Beauty and terror
      Just keep going    
       No feeling is final
Reiner Maria Rilke (1899)

@Ingénierie RCI 

 As frustrating as it sounds, this is not a WLC or AP problem. Clients make the call on the roaming not the network.  Update client driver to lasted and check roaming sensibility on the client wireless adapter. 

 

Haydn Andrews
VIP Alumni
VIP Alumni

Things like 802.11v and client loadbalancing could do it, however generally find that its related to client drivers or poor RF design

*****Help out other by using the rating system and marking answered questions as "Answered"*****
*** Please rate helpful posts ***

Leo Laohoo
Hall of Fame
Hall of Fame

Is this happening to just one wireless client?

Rich R
VIP
VIP

Enable Radioactive Trace for an affected MAC address while it roams and then feed the output into the Debug Analyzer (link below) to see how it looks from the WLC point of view.

But as the others have pointed out already, roaming is always a client decision so you need to look at why the client is deciding to roam (all the factors already mentioned by the others).  Start by updating the client drivers to latest version before testing.  For Intel: https://www.intel.com/content/www/us/en/download/19351/intel-wireless-wi-fi-drivers-for-windows-10-and-windows-11.html

------------------------------
Please click Helpful if this post helped you and Accept as Solution (drop down menu at top right of this reply) if this answered your query.
------------------------------
TAC recommended codes for AireOS WLC's   and   TAC recommended codes for 9800 WLC's
Best Practices for AireOS WLC's,   Best Practices for 9800 WLC's   and   Cisco Wireless compatibility matrix
Check your 9800 WLC config with Wireless Config Analyzer using "show tech wireless" output or "config paging disable" then "show run-config" output on AireOS and use Wireless Debug Analyzer to analyze your WLC client debugs
Field Notice: FN63942 APs and WLCs Fail to Create CAPWAP Connections Due to Certificate Expiration
Field Notice: FN72424 Later Versions of WiFi 6 APs Fail to Join WLC - Software Upgrade Required
Field Notice: FN72524 IOS APs stuck in downloading state after 4 Dec 2022 due to Certificate Expired
- Fixed in 8.10.196.0, latest 9800 releases, 8.5.182.12 (8.5.182.13 for 3504) and 8.5.182.109 (IRCM, 8.5.182.111 for 3504)
Field Notice: FN70479 AP Fails to Join or Joins with 1 Radio due to Country Mismatch, RMA needed
Field Notice: FN74383 APs Running 17.12.4/5/6/6a May Run Out of Flash Space Preventing Upgrades
How to avoid boot loop due to corrupted image on Wave 2 and Catalyst 11ax Access Points (CSCvx32806)
Field Notice: FN74035 - Wave2 APs DFS May Not Detect Radar After Channel Availability Check Time
Leo's list of bugs affecting 2800/3800/4800/1560 APs
Default AP console baud rate from 17.12.x is 115200 - introduced by CSCwe88390

atila.kis11
Frequent Visitor
Frequent Visitor

We had the same issue a while ago. Solved this whit changes on the client NIC.
Lowered the Roaming aggressiveness and lowered the TX power. That solved the issue for us.

Ambuj M
VIP
VIP

check the log and confirm if you are seeing this CO_CLIENT_DELETE_REASON_DOT11_MAX_STA ?

recently had roaming issue reported, but we were hitting https://bst.cisco.com/quickview/bug/CSCwo37680

had a simple fix and then roaming worked like a charm.

-hope this helps-

Bdas1
Frequent Visitor
Frequent Visitor

What was the fix you made?

 

aipan-zhao
Frequent Visitor
Frequent Visitor

Regarding this issue, I have encountered a similar problem now. Have you found a solution yet?

Review Cisco Networking for a $25 gift card